Understanding JIC Fitting Sizes

JIC fittings comprise a common type of fitting used in hydraulic and pneumatic applications. These possess a specific size system that is crucial for ensuring proper connections and preventing leaks. When choosing JIC fittings, it's important to grasp the various sizes available or. JIC fittings are typically sized by their outside diameter (OD), which is measured in inches.

Common JIC fitting sizes include 1/4 inch, 3/8 inch, 1/2 inch, and 5/8 inch, but other sizes may also be available depending on the unique application.

It's essential to carefully choose the appropriate JIC fitting size to match your hose. Using a fitting that is too small can lead leaks or damage to the tubing, while using a fitting that is too large may create an insecure connection.

Choosing the Correct JIC Fitting Size

When assembling hydraulic systems, selecting the correct JIC fitting size is essential. Incorrect sizing can lead to leaks, pressure loss, and system failure. To ensure a proper fit, consider the dimension of your hose and the required flow rate. Consult manufacturer specifications for guidance on appropriate JIC fitting sizes based on these factors. Additionally, it's important to check that the fitting threads match those of your hydraulic components for a secure connection.

  • Make sure to use fittings rated for the system pressure.
  • Inspect fittings for damage before installation.
  • Use approved lubricants on threads for a secure and leak-free seal.
